TrialDirector Wins 6th Annual Law Technology News Awards

TrialDirector Wins LTN Gold Award (top honors) for Trial Presentation Software and Bronze Award for Litigation Support Software

December 5, 2008 (New York, NY) -   Law Technology News ("LTN") magazine announced today the winners of its Sixth Annual Law Technology News Awards, which recognizes the leaders in the field for both innovation and implementation of technology. TrialDirector Version 5.1, the leading trial presentation software developed by inData Corporation, won the Gold award in the category of Trial Presentation Software coming in first place for the third
consecutive year since the category was created.  


For the first time ever, TrialDirector also won an LTN award in the category of Litigation Support Software. It is the only trial presentation software representing a win in the category, taking home the Bronze. Concordance 2007 won the Gold award for Litigation Support Software; CT Summation iBlaze won the Silver award.

In 2008, the editors of Law Technology News asked the publication's 40,000+ subscribers to select products and vendors that represented outstanding achievement in legal technology in 25 categories. Ballots were solicited from LTN's subscriber audience of law firm partners and managing partners, legal administrators, MIS/IT specialists, corporate counsel, litigation support specialists, and other legal professionals. Winners were determined based on the most-mentioned product/company in each category.

The winners in the vendor categories were announced on Friday, December 5, 2008. The awards will be presented at the LTN Technology Awards Dinner at LegalTech New York on February 2, 2009. Other vendor categories include Product of the Year, Case Management Software, Collaboration Tools, Litigation Support Consultant, and Time and Billing Software, among others. The full list of winners may be found on LTN's Web site.

In addition to the vendor categories, LTN also awards law firms for their innovation and implementation in several categories, including IT Director, Champion of Technology, Most Innovative Use of Technology, and more. Law firm winners will be chosen by a panel of technology experts from among the law firm nominations and announced at a later date.

TrialDirector Version 5.x has won the LTN Award for Trial Presentation Software for the past three (3) consecutive years since the category was first created by LTN. TrialDirector also won the LTN Award for Product of the Year in 2007. inData Corporation has previously won the LTN Award for Litigation Support Service/Consultant.
